Bildnis und Brauch: Studien zur Bildfunktion der Effigies.  
   

 
Author Brückner, Wolfgang
Place of Publication Berlin
Publication Name Erich Schmidt Verlag
Year 1966
Language(s) German
Description
RARE comprehensive monograph on effigies and its functions in sepulchral and punishment rites from Middle Ages to 19th-century by Wolfgang Brückner (b.1930), an eminent German folklorist and Germanist.
